There are many potential applications for protective plastic hardcoatings. In the case of polymer optics, the need may simply be for enhanced hardness/abrasion resistance. Substrates such as injection-molded display windows or molded optics that may need to be cleaned in the field of use are strong candidates for plastic optical hardcoatings. We offer a low-cost dip-applied plastic hardcoating, as well as a sophisticated plasma polymerization vacuum hardcoating process. In certain glass substrate applications such as scanner windows, low friction hard surfaces are needed to maintain good optical transmission. Our proprietary thin-film processes are designed to meet many surface protection requirements.
